If you have never heard of Vintage Cosmetics products are highly curated to compliment a woman's skin tone, with pigments that pop and highlight her features while delivering comfort and long wear benefits! I will say although their website collection is small, everything seems to be pretty top notch and high quality from what I have tried! They have eyeshadow palettes, mascara, blush and highlighters as well as makeup brushes! As far as price point, its sort of pricey however for the items I reviewed I honestly believe the price is totally worth it. Lets start off with the Illuminating Face Highlighter Set, I was honestly shocked when I seen these in person. Shocked as in when you see a hot guy walk by and your mouth drops, well that's what I mean, haha. It comes with two shades, Rose Quartz and Chocolate Diamond. Ever since I got it, I haven't stopped wearing it! Both shades are so gorgeous on the skin, its great topped on either a blush or bronzer or just as a plain highlight! It adds the perfect radiance to your skin, and reflects perfectly outside in the sun! It swatches even more gorgeous outside in the sun than in room lighting, they are so buttery. It is currently priced at $35. Your getting a big pan sized amount of product. Although it may sound pricey, for the product itself it is so worth it! Whenever I'm looking for a highlighter that I know wont budge, this is the one I go for! Plus its not a huge palette, so its perfect for traveling and fits easily inside your purse or makeup bag.




As for the Blush and Brighten Face Palette, I was very scared of the colors not going to lie. The pigmentation of these blushes are extreme. They are very buttery and smooth. With colors this bright sometimes you have to use an easy hand when they are applied. They have two options for palettes. the one I have is the Blossom and Poppy shades. There is also a palette with the shades, Pink Coral and Flamingo. With a slight brush on your cheeks, you'll get a gorgeous pop of color with a matte finish. This palette as well is priced at $35. In my opinion I really like the Highlighter better than the blush palette. However I've been using it a lot more recently and I have gotten a lot more used to the colors!
